Urban Mobility Solutions

Cities face a variety of problems, including pollution, congestion and accessibility. Urban mobility solutions that leverage advanced technologies can improve the living standards, boost economic growth and decrease the environmental impact.

Implementing these solutions however, requires collaboration across the entire system of mobility. It is essential to adopt an approach that is centered on the city, and geared towards citizens. Working with cities, cross-industry partners and Mercedes-Benz experts allows for a tailor-made solution to each city's specific needs.

Congestion

The challenges of congestion have long been a central aspect of urban mobility planning. Traffic time reduces individuals' productivity and lowers the effectiveness of cities in general. As a result, cities have to balance innovation in transportation with the need to address the effects of increasing populations and aging infrastructure.

Urban transportation systems should be accessible and safe, while making sure that they reduce noise, pollution, and waste. In addition, cities have to address challenges such as parking management, traffic congestion and decarbonization.

There are a variety of strategies to deal with congestion However, the most effective approach requires everyone to take responsibility of the problem. It is important to recognize that congestion isn't simply a nuisance. It also has an economic impact on businesses as well as the economy overall. This is why it is crucial to use accurate, high-resolution data that captures day-to-day variations in electric travel mobility scooters times to determine the causes of congestion as well as the most effective solutions.

In addition to observing traffic conditions, it is essential to communicate to the public and businesses how congestion impacts their operations. Clear and consistent messaging can increase awareness, inform the public on solutions, and encourage leaders of businesses to promote strategies to reduce congestion.

A solution is to increase the capacity of roads. However, this is costly and is subject to a variety of restrictions such as environmental and land-use regulations. Other options include promoting alternative methods of transportation like taxi hailing apps and bikeshare programs, or using congestion pricing and carpooling. Parking systems can also be inefficient and cause congestion. Utilizing smart parking solutions can improve space utilization and shift travel away from busy roads.

Aging Infrastructure

veleco-zt15-3-wheeled-mobility-scooter-fAcross the country, towns and cities are struggling to deal with traffic congestion and safety issues caused by aging infrastructure. Bridges and roads are at risk as traffic volumes continue to increase, putting residents and business owners at risk. Travel times also increase.

The aging infrastructure for transportation is a challenge that will not be solved with technology alone. The Oregon Department of Transportation is working to address this issue by investing in new highways and other transportation projects that will reduce traffic congestion, improve safety and modernize the infrastructure. These investments will help to ensure that the Portland region will continue to grow for generations to come.

As urbanization continues to accelerate, many nations are facing the challenge of finding affordable homes and the demand for sustainable solutions in lightweight mobility scooter travel electric scooter for seniors is increasing. Innovative solutions such as e-scooters and ebuses are being developed in order to reduce carbon emissions and Electric Three Wheel Mobility Scooter slow climate change. These new mobility solutions also help to increase accessibility for disabled people, which is a growing concern for many citizens.

This study employs an organized literature survey (SLR) in order to study 62 scientific articles and forecast the evolution of different scenarios up until 2030. The gradual development of shared and automated mobility is expected to be most important in changing the way we move. The scenario "Mine is Yours" dominates (35 percent) followed by "Grumpy Old Transport" (18%) and "Tech-eager Mobility" (17 percent). To make these new mobility options accepted by society, innovative legislation and policies will be required.

Inequality

Urban mobility solutions should not only improve traffic flow and reduce emissions however, they must also be socially sustainable and economically viable for everyone. Transportation is typically one of the biggest household expenditures, and those costs can disproportionately affect people with low incomes. High car payments, fuel, insurance and maintenance costs can be a major financial burden to families and keep them from obtaining employment or even education. Moreover long commutes long can be detrimental to the health of the residents.

Public transportation is an attractive alternative to private vehicles, however, many cities aren't equipped with the infrastructure necessary. The outdated public transportation system was designed to serve smaller populations and needs a substantial investment to modernize. Additionally, a lack of funds and outdated technology can hinder the development of new services.

Additionally, congestion can increase the amount of pollutants present in the air, and is a threat to public health. The resultant poor air quality can worsen respiratory conditions and reduce the overall quality of life. By enhancing and expanding the existing infrastructure, congestion can be avoided by implementing a smart urban electric mobility scooters for adults with seat plan.

The expansion of the capacity of public transport will cut travel times and make it more accessible for all, including those with disabilities and infirmities. Furthermore, it will reduce the burden on households who have expensive cars and free up valuable parking spaces that can be put to use to serve more productive needs.

The increasing use of alternative transportation methods could have a direct impact on the level of inequality. As the density of cities increases, Black-White and AAPI-White commuting inequality decreases, while women's commute time decreases in comparison to men's. This suggests that growing densities force AAPIs to trade comparable salaries for longer commutes, which then forces Blacks to work further away and women to be less able to access jobs that match their qualifications and skills.

Air Quality

As research shows, there is a direct link between exposure to harmful pollutants and health. Heavy traffic congestion, gasoline and diesel vehicle use and other factors can lead to high levels of particulate (PM2.5 and PM10) and gases such as nitrogen oxides, sulphur dioxide, volatile organic compounds and carbon monoxide. These pollutants are harmful and can cause climate change.

Exposure to such pollutants can trigger heart attacks asthma, lung irritation and heart attacks and can cause delays in the development of children and cognitive decline. In addition, they can contribute to ozone pollution and greenhouse gas formation, as well as the urban heat island effect, which causes higher temperatures in cities.

The development of public transportation is a beneficial way to improve the quality of air and encourage active mobility. can reduce the emissions of transport, including greenhouse gases. Moreover by reducing emissions from urban transportation can help achieve local, national and international climate goals.

Smart mobility solutions can be utilized to encourage commuters to choose low-emission vehicles and electric three wheel Mobility scooter vehicles. They can also provide information on safe walking and biking routes. They can also encourage ridesharing services, which helps to reduce the number of cars on the road and the pollution associated with them.

In a recent paper in which we conducted a simulation of SUMPs' (Sustainable Urban lightweight mobility scooter travel electric scooter for seniors Plans) impact on 642 cities across Europe. Our results show that SUMPs have a considerable impact on the modelled "urban background concentrations" of PM2.5 and NO2, with the average reductions in these substances amounting to around 7%. It is important to note that these results only consider the emissions from the transport industry and urban background concentrations. Other benefits of SUMPs such as reduced energy consumption, street-level concentrations and electro-electric mobility scooter foldable options are not evaluated in this study and should be considered in future studies.

Logistics

Urban mobility solutions must be built around an ecosystem model that involves multiple stakeholders. They must take into account technology, equity and sustainability, while being tailored to the unique environment of each city. While new technologies can be beneficial urban mobility systems, they should be able to integrate existing infrastructure, encourage bike share and public transport programs, and improve safety.

Logistics is the process of moving people and goods in a city, and is the core of urban mobility. It is crucial for reducing traffic, electric three Wheel mobility scooter maximizing commute time and improving travel accessibility. The development of new technology such as autonomous vehicles (AVs) will have direct impact on the city's logistics. It will also make the transportation sector more effective. This is due to the need for human drivers, decrease fatal accidents caused by driver errors and increase traffic flow.

Logistics is complicated due to its many stakeholders. Each has their own goals, budgets, and legacy technologies. It is therefore difficult to ensure the consistent implementation of a plan. Additionally, it can be hard to transfer and scale solutions from one location to another since each has its own needs.

To meet these challenges cities must promote technological innovation and develop flexible, efficient logistical operations that can grow with ongoing advances in technology. This can be accomplished by the promotion of green freight management, integrating environmentally friendly urban logistics planning into SULPs and SUMPs and exploring the potential of air mobility via drones. It is also important to encourage collaboration between public transportation agencies, private companies and logistics service providers. This will help improve transit and make cities more flexible, thereby improving the quality of life for the citizens.
